
Parsigecko is a monotypic genus of lizards in the family Gekkonidae. It contains one species, Parsigecko ziaiei, known as '''Ziaie's Pars-gecko'''. It is found in southern Iran.

==Description== The adult, gravid female holotype had a snout-to-vent length of with a slender body across, and an elongated snout. The tail was broken but regenerated, longer than the body, with smooth dorsal caudal scales and two strongly keeled scales on the sides of each annulus. The precloacal area was covered with enlarged, elongated scales arranged in a single arch-shaped row, presumably carrying precloacal pores in males.
